Are eggs good for hemorrhoids?
Foods Low in Fiber
Hemorrhoid sufferers may also want to limit consumption of low-fiber foods such as meat, fish, eggs, and dairy products. Instead, choose whole grain foods like whole-wheat bread, oatmeal, and brown rice – and eat plenty of fruits and vegetables with the skin.

Is banana good for hemorrhoids?
One medium, 7–8-inch (18–20-cm) banana provides 3 grams of fiber ( 40 ). While its pectin creates a gel in your digestive tract, its resistant starch feeds your friendly gut bacteria — a great combination to help your hemorrhoids.Is yogurt good for hemorrhoids?
Yogurt and other probiotics can be a part of a healthy, well-rounded diet that reduces hemorrhoid symptoms, help them heal faster and may offer support in preventing a recurrence.What kind of juice is good for hemorrhoids?

Diet. You may become constipated if you don't eat enough high-fiber foods like vegetables, fruits, and whole grains. Also, eating a lot of high-fat meats, dairy products and eggs, or rich desserts and sugary sweets may cause constipation.How long do hemorrhoids take to heal?
Hemorrhoids TreatmentHemorrhoid symptoms usually go away on their own. Your doctor's treatment plan will depend on how severe your symptoms are. Home remedies. Simple lifestyle changes can often relieve mild hemorrhoid symptoms within 2 to 7 days.

Eggs. Some people believe that eggs can cause constipation. However, there is not much scientific evidence that supports this. They are a low fiber food, though, so eating a lot of them may contribute to constipation.Do eggs cause bloating?
Eggs contain sulfur, which some people have trouble digesting, producing gas and bloating symptoms. Also, it might be related to a food sensitivity to the egg white, yolk, or both. Finally, if you have irritable bowel syndrome (IBS), you might have difficulty digesting certain foods generally, including eggs.
